Brattleboro, Vermont (map) is most easily reached by car, but there are good bus and train options as well. CarBennington VT: 40 miles (64 km) W, 1 hour Boston MA: 105 miles (169 km) SE, 2.5 hours Keene NH: 19 miles (31 km) NE, 35 minutes New York City NY: 208 miles (335 km) SW, 4 hours Springfield MA: 58 miles (93 km) S, 1 hour BusGreyhound Lines connects Brattleboro with Burlington VT, Springfield MA (a major New England bus transport hub) and Hartford CT. More... Connecticut River Transit, under the name The Current, operates buses in Brattleboro and between the Brattleboro and the Vermont towns of Bellows Falls, Ludlow, Rutland and Springfield. TrainBrattleboro is a stop on Amtrak's Vermonter train between Washington DC, New York City, and the Vermont towns including Brattleboro, Bellows Falls, Claremont, Windsor, White River Junction (for Woodstock), Randolph, Montpelier, Waterbury, Essex Junction (for Burlington) and St Albans on the Canadian border. More... AirplaneThe nearest airport to Brattleboro is Keene NH's Keene Dillant Hopkins Airport, 20 miles (32 km) to the east. Bradley International Airport in Windsor Locks CT is 78 miles (125 km, 1.5 hours) to the south. Albany (NY) International Airport is 81 miles (130 km, 2 hours) to the west. Boston's Logan International Airport is 117 miles (188 km, 2.25 hours) to the southeast. —by Tom Brosnahan
